Jared Goff - 2025 Season in Review
Jared Goff had one of his most productive seasons in 2025, despite shaky, at best, offensive line play, and missing one of his favorite targets in Sam LaPorta for the last 7 games of the season. Bo Nix - 2025 Season in Review
Bo Nix may be one of the more intriguing quarterbacks to talk about in the league. Since coming to the league Nix has done nothing but compile stats. Over 8,500 total yards, 54 passing touchdowns, 9 rushing touchdowns, a career 24-10 starting record, which has equated to two playoff appearances in his first two seasons.
